Donovan, Gray Represent Basketball Squads on Skyline All-Sportsmanship Teams

NEW YORK — Kristen Donovan (Maspeth, N.Y./Archbishop Molloy) of women's basketball and Noah Gray (Panama City, Fla./Deane Bozeman) of men's basketball represent St. Joseph's University, N.Y. – Brooklyn on the Skyline Conference All-Sportsmanship Teams for their respective sports, as announced by the conference office on Tuesday afternoon.

Donovan earns the distinction for the third time, featuring at the end of the 2022-23 and 2023-24 seasons. The junior finished the season third in the Skyline Conference with a .318 three-point field-goal percentage and seventh with 13 points per game. She most recently earned an honorable mention from the Metropolitan Basketball Writers Association, the first of her collegiate career,  averaging 17.5 points and 11 rebounds over 80 minutes in wins over Sarah Lawrence and Yeshiva.

Gray started 14 of the 22 games he featured in his rookie season. He produced a season-best 14 points in the first game of the Electric City Classic against hosts Marywood in November, adding eight rebounds to his statline. Later that month, the first-year pulled 11 boards to go with seven points in the Bears' 64-61 victory over Penn State-Abington. Gray finished the season second on the team in blocks (11) and fifth in rebounds (74).

The Skyline Conference recognizes All-Sportsmanship Team members in all 19 of its championship sports, with each program announcing one recipient for his or her sportsmanlike demeanor – both in and out of competition.
